Grant Description

On November 4, 2016, the Government of China granted the World Health Organization USD$500,000 to provide emergency humanitarian aid to Syria. This funding was dedicated to enhancing trauma care management and surgical rehabilitation services.

The aid represents a part of the contributed to the 2016 Syria Humanitarian Response Plan (UN project code SYR-16/H/88477/122).

The plan requested USD$3.19bn for the implementation of its plan, but only USD$1.75bn was raised by member states in the usage year of 2016. This project is captured by UNOCHA flow #151573.
